English singer-songwriter (born 1988)
↗ WikipediaJames Blake Litherland is an English singer-songwriter and record producer. Known for his emotive, soulful light head voice and use of falsetto, he first gained recognition following the release of three extended plays—The Bells Sketch, CMYK and Klavierwerke—in 2010. He signed with A&M Records to release his self-titled debut album (2011) the following year, which was met with critical praise and peaked within the top ten of the UK Albums Chart.
